The implications of land practices for peat bogs

Is the European Commission aware of the potential damage that could be sustained by plant microbial communities on peatland as a result of the construction of wind farms in response to the renewable energy targets set by the Commission? Peatlands have already been altered by burning, draining, forestry and grazing, disrupting the natural dynamics of the peat bogs. As we are unaware of the implications of such land practices for peat bogs, can full Environmental Impact Assessments and scientific studies using historical records, palaeoenvironmental data and aerial photography on land proposed for wind farms be considered before a proposal is accepted?
